Todd Haimes, who saved New York’s Roundabout Theatre Company from bankruptcy and turned it into one of the largest nonprofit theaters in America, has died at 66.The artistic director and CEO of Roundabout passed away on Wednesday at New York’s Memorial Sloan Kettering Hospital of complications from osteosarcoma, a bone .His passing was announced by Roundabout spokesman Matt Polk. Haimes battled with the cancer since 2002, when he was first diagnosed with sarcoma of the jaw.
